Amenities & Services
Eight offers 20 ensuite rooms spread across two adjacent Georgian townhouses, one facing Abbey Green and the other on North Parade Passage. The hotel provides a shared lounge with a cosy honesty bar stocked with drinks and snacks, open until 11:30 PM. Guests receive White Company toiletries and earplugs in each room, plus free WiFi throughout the property.
Rooms & Suites
Each of the 20 rooms is individually designed with a flat-screen TV, desk, Nespresso coffee machine, and tea/coffee making facilities. Bathrooms are private with either a shower or bathtub, and select rooms offer city views or views of the 230-year-old plane tree on Abbey Green. Rooms range from Snug Doubles to Superior King Rooms, with attic-style rooms on the top floor and triple rooms that accommodate families with a single bed plus a double.
Location
The hotel sits 200 metres from The Roman Baths and Bath Abbey, and 400 metres from Bath Spa Train Station, placing guests in the pedestrianised historic centre. All major attractions, including The Circus Bath and Royal Crescent, are within a 14-minute walk. Nearby streets offer local artisan shops, Sally Lunn's Museum, and free music in the Plaza.
Dining
Breakfast is served in the hotel's small restaurant and includes à la carte, continental, and Full English/Irish options, with a proper coffee menu. The honesty bar in the basement lounge offers a self-service selection of wines, beers, and spirits. Guests also find homemade biscuits in their rooms and complimentary bottled water.
Guest Experience
Staff provide luggage storage for early arrivals and deliver bags to rooms once ready, allowing guests to explore immediately. The front desk is available until 6 PM, with self-check-in instructions provided for late arrivals. Note that there is no lift and no on-site parking; the nearest public car park is a 5-minute walk at the Cricket Club.
